Output 32c62bce046b8ae5662960a429178bb4512318766c7ae0c9bbac2c3ccce60b4d:5

value
1000
script pubkey
OP_0 OP_PUSHBYTES_20 3c86cc6ab5ef363861d459e4fc9b31b9a2c6cd96
address
tb1q8jrvc644aumrscw5t8j0exe3hx3vdnvk4yaa7g
transaction
32c62bce046b8ae5662960a429178bb4512318766c7ae0c9bbac2c3ccce60b4d